Runbook: Account Recovery — CrumbWorks Order Service. The bakery order-cutoff rule locks order edits at 16:00 local daily. If the cutoff scheduler account is lost, recovery must complete before the next cutoff window or pending orders freeze. The release manager authorizes recovery and enters the passphrase noted below.

vault phrase of taweg-kafof = oliax-zorael

Account recovery — Rowanest Report Builder

Heads up, newcomers: when you rebuild a locked-out admin account, the report builder re-runs its sort pipeline, and we rely on stable sorting to keep column order sane. Don't "fix" ties by hand — the restorer handles them deterministically. Just run the recovery script, wait for the sort-stability check to pass, and confirm the admin can open at least one saved report. When the script prompts for vault access, enter the recovery passphrase below.

unlock words, tawif-tahop: oliys-ulawyn-tamdor-lamys-casox-jormir-fraius-kasath-ulador-ulamir-holir-sorys-holeth

The service sheds load by pausing low-priority topics when downstream delivery latency climbs, so misconfigured thresholds can silently delay transactional messages for hours. Always deploy to the staging ring in Bellmarsh first and watch the pause-rate dashboard for at least fifteen minutes before promoting. The values below must match across all regions or the shed logic will flap. Current production settings follow.

deployment values, kajep-kageg:
[praix]
host = praix.paliqcorp.corp
user = praix_svc
database = praix_prod

Subject: Goods lift booked tonight

Hi night crew,

Heads up — the goods lift at Merivale House is reserved for the Calloway Fittings delivery from 22:00 to 02:00. Please keep the loading bay corridor clear and use the stairs for anything small. The delivery driver will buzz reception's night line. To open the bay-side door for them, use the pass below.

turnstile pass: bdg-FVNQRS-72965873

Handover: Marla → Deven. ProfileStore sharding on Quellix is half done. Shards 0–7 live, 8–15 pending rebalance. Run the cutover script only after dual-write verification passes. New folks: don't touch the legacy Harkell cluster. If the migration vault locks mid-cutover, unlock with the passphrase below.

unlock words, kawig-bawef: belax-sorir-druax-ulaiel-wenael-belael